How much do software trainee j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 13, 2026, the average hourly pay for software trainee in Georgia is $17.86,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$12.98 and $20.48 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a software developer trainee?

A software developer trainee is an entry-level position for individuals learning software development skills, often involving training programs, mentorship, and hands-on experience with programming languages, tools, and development environments. Trainees typically work under supervision to gain practical knowledge and may pursue certifications or courses to enhance their skills.

What are Software Trainees?

Software Trainees are entry-level professionals who are typically recent graduates or individuals new to the software industry. They undergo training to learn programming languages, software development methodologies, and company-specific tools under the guidance of senior developers or mentors. Their main role is to gain practical experience, contribute to projects, and build foundational skills necessary to become full-fledged software developers.

The main difference between a Software Trainee and a Software Developer lies in experience and responsibilities. Software Trainees are usually in training or internship phases, focusing on learning and assisting in projects. Software Developers are experienced professionals responsible for designing and implementing software solutions. Both roles often require similar educational backgrounds, but their scope and expectations differ significantly.

What are the typical challenges a Software Trainee might face in their first few months, and how can they overcome them?

As a Software Trainee, you may initially find it challenging to adapt to new programming languages, development tools, and company workflows. It's common to feel overwhelmed by unfamiliar codebases or agile methodologies. To overcome these challenges, seek guidance from mentors, actively participate in team meetings, and take advantage of training resources provided by your employer. Consistent practice, asking questions, and collaborating with teammates will help you build confidence and develop your skills more efficiently.

What are the skills required for a trainee software engineer?

A trainee software engineer should have a strong foundation in programming languages such as Java, C++, or Python, along with basic understanding of data structures and algorithms. Knowledge of software development tools like version control systems (e.g., Git), and familiarity with databases and operating systems are also important. Good problem-solving skills, the ability to learn quickly, and teamwork are essential for success in this role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Software Trainee,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Software Trainee, you need a basic understanding of programming languages, problem-solving abilities, and a relevant degree or coursework in computer science or IT. Familiarity with development tools such as IDEs, version control systems like Git, and exposure to databases or basic frameworks is typically expected. Eagerness to learn, attention to detail, and effective communication are soft skills that set top trainees apart. These qualifications are crucial for quickly adapting to new technologies, collaborating with teams, and delivering reliable software solutions.

Tom Barrow Company is a premier manufacturer's representative in the HVAC industry, offering a wide range of commercial and industrial HVAC products across the Southeast. Known for our strong client relationships and technical expertise, we serve engineers, contractors, and building owners with reliable, high-performance solutions.
As part of the Impact Climate Technologies (ICT) family of companies, we are backed by a leading HVAC solutions platform serving customers across North America through 36 locations. Together, we support mission-critical environments-from data centers and healthcare to complex commercial facilities.
Our work is guided by ICT's RECIPE values-Respect & Collaboration, Excellence Always, Customer Commitment, Integrity First, People-Centered leadership, and Expertise & Innovation. These principles shape how we work with our customers, support our teams, and partner with one another every day.
We take a forward-thinking approach, delivering scalable, energy-efficient, and reliable solutions while building long-term partnerships through exceptional service, technical expertise, and support.
The Sales Trainee program is designed to prepare motivated, career-driven individuals for a long-term career in Outside Sales. Trainees begin by learning Tom Barrow's products, pricing tools, and estimating processes before transitioning into an Outside Sales Engineer role, managing accounts and driving business growth. This role is ideal for someone with a strong interest in technical sales, excellent communication skills, and a desire to grow within a supportive, team-oriented environment. Hands-on training will be provided.
